On the second day of a new feature on Keith Olbermann’s Countdown show, called "Quick Comments," the MSNBC host turned his attention to Neal Boortz -- whom he called a "hate radio host" and referred to as being "dehumanized" -- and others who oppose the implementation of ObamaCare, accusing them of "killing 45,000 people every year," and suggesting that those who seek to block universal health care are as bad as terrorists. As Olbermann cited a dubious study which claimed that 45,000 people die in America each year because they lack health insurance, the Countdown host charged:
What would you do, sir, if terrorists were killing 45,000 people every year in this country? Well, the current health care system, the insurance companies, and those who support them are doing just that. ... Those fighting health care reform – not those debating its shape or its nuance – people who demand the status quo, they are killing 45,000 Americans a year.
Olbermann concluded by comparing ObamaCare opponents to terrorists: "Because they die individually of disease and not disaster, Neil Boortz and those who ape him in office and out, approve their deaths, all 45,000 of them – a year – in America. Remind me again, who are the terrorists?"
As previously documented by the NewsBuster Brent Baker, the CBS Evening News and ABC’s World News have both promoted the same report as a "Harvard study," although, as recounted by Baker, it "was really produced by the Physicians for a National Health Program (PNHP), a left-wing advocacy group which touts itself as ‘the only national physician organization in the United States dedicated exclusively to implementing a single-payer national health program.’ Study co-author Dr. Steffie Woolhandler of PNHP is one of five signers of an ‘Open Letter to President Obama to Support Single-Payer Health Care.’"

David Dranove: As it turns out, a figure of 0 additional deaths might also be correct. That is because the Harvard study uses a methodology that is inherently biased.
Michelle Malkin: So, how did these political doctors come up with the 44,000 figure? They used data from a health survey conducted between 1988 and 1994. The questionnaires asked a sample of 9,000 participants if they were insured and how they rated their own health. The federal Centers for Disease Control tracked the deaths of people in the sample group through the year 2000. Drs. Himmelstein, Woolhandler, and company then crunched the numbers and attributed deaths to lack of health insurance for all the participants who initially self-reported that they had no insurance and then died for any reason over the 12-year tracking period.
